  • coal liquefaction - the conversion of coal into liquid hydrocarbon fuel. The various liquefaction processes fundamentally involve reducing the carbon to hydrogen weight ratio of the coal either by adding hydrogen or by removing part of the carbon as coke or carbon dioxide. The by-products of coal liquefaction range from waxes and heavy oils to light gasolines and gases, depending on the process and amount of hydrogen employed.
